Background

FOXP3 Antibody: FOXP3 is a member of the forkhead/winged-helix family of transcriptional regulators. FOXP3 acts as a repressor of transcription and regulates T cell activation, with its overexpression in CD4 T cells leading to an attenuation of activation-induced cytokine production and proliferation. In regulatory T (Treg) cells, FOXP3 is essential for Treg suppressor function and its expression leads to the repression of IL-17 expression. Genetic mutations involving FOXP3 are the cause of immunodeficiency polyendocrinopathy, enteropathy, X-linked syndrome (IPEX), also known as X-linked autoimmunity-immunodeficiency syndrome.
